    Calculating a running percentage

    Hi folks, could you help me with the attached file please? I'm having problems getting my percentages to calculate. It works the way I have done it (by adding the individual cells to the formula) but it's not very nice and if I add more lines in I'll need to edit the formula. The formulas are in colum H. I know there is a way to do this using ranges but for the life of me I can't remember how to do it.

    Re: Calculating a running percentage

    Hello
    Try the following formula copied down column H.

    =(SUM($E$4:E4)+SUM($F$4:F4))/SUM($D$4:D4)
